What to Expect After A Facelift?

Recovery time depends on a patient’s age, health status, and specific procedure desired. Patients are usually able to return to their normal activities within two to three weeks but should wait approximately one month before engaging in any strenuous exercise. Limiting sun exposure and living a healthy lifestyle will help preserve results.

Recovery: Week 1

Postoperative incision care is important for preventing infection and to ensure proper healing. Bruising and swelling reach their height during the first few days and resolve over the course of several weeks. Continue to take pain medication as needed. You should be able to resume most light activities by the end of week one.

Recovery: Week 2

In some cases, the swelling and bruising around the treatment area causes numbness or tingling. None of these common occurrences should be cause for concern. At the end of two weeks, you may be ready to return to more strenuous daily activities.

Full Recovery from Facelift Procedures

You will begin to see real improvements in your facial contours almost immediately, despite bruising and swelling. You may resume exercising and normal activities within the 2-4 week window after surgery. Incision sites will have a pinkish-red hue, but any other noticeable signs of your procedure are minimal.

Patients who take the necessary precautions and follow the recommended postoperative care instructions experience the easiest recoveries and best outcomes. Communication between you and your surgeon is encouraged, from questions you have to symptoms you feel are abnormal.
